WebFeb 11, 2024 · 3. Informal Diction. Informal diction leaves out stuffy, proper grammar, proper English words in favor of the conversational tone and manner that most people speak in. It is important to think of how ordinary people talk when using informal diction. Informal diction examples include yep, nope, I dunno, and hey. Colloquial diction. Colloquial words or expressions are informal in nature and generally represent a certain region or time. “Ain’t” and “y’all” are examples of colloquial expressions, born in rural areas of the United States. Colloquialisms add color and realism to writing. 5. Slang diction. how does duo passwordless work
